How much do baycare j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for baycare in the United States is $19.90,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.83 and $21.39 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is BayCare and what types of jobs do they offer?

BayCare is a leading not-for-profit healthcare system based in Florida, offering a wide range of jobs in hospitals, outpatient facilities, and physician offices. They employ healthcare professionals such as nurses, doctors, technicians, and administrative staff, as well as support roles in areas like IT, finance, and customer service. BayCare is known for its commitment to patient care, employee development, and community health. Job seekers can find both clinical and non-clinical opportunities across various locations in the BayCare network.

Job description

BayCare Medical Group is actively recruiting a BE/BC Neurologist to join our established and highly regarded office on the campus of Morton Plant Hospital in Clearwater, Florida.  The position is open to general neurologists and those with subspecialty training, including movement disorders, neurophysiology, and dementia/memory disorders. This well-established practice offers a strong collaborative team, supportive hospital leadership, and a large, diverse patient population.

Highlights of this Exceptional Opportunity:

 

  • Join a collaborative, experienced team of two neurologists and one nurse practitioner.
  • Assume a robust population of patients affected by dementia, memory loss, movement disorders, and other neurological conditions in need of advanced diagnosis and ongoing treatment.
  • Opportunity to tailor your practice based on subspecialty interests and expertise.
  • Access to a strong interdisciplinary care team, including clinical neuropsychologists, neurosurgeons, neurohospitalists, and interventional radiologists.
  • Research opportunities available through BayCare’s Neuro Science Institute, a major initiative focused on advancing neurological care.
  • Benefit from an existing primary care referral base and large potential for growth and success.
  • Open to both experienced candidates and new graduates.

BayCare Health System is a not-for-profit 501(c)(3) organization, comprising a network of 16 hospitals and a wide range of services, including imaging, laboratory, behavioral health, home health care, and urgent care. Our mission is to connect patients with a full spectrum of preventive, diagnostic, and treatment services to meet their health care needs throughout their lifetime.
